To apply for the UENR 2026/2027 academic year, purchase an e-voucher for GHS 230–300 at Ghana Post Offices, GCB Bank, or via
*885#. Complete the online form on the Admissions Portal using your PIN/Application Number, then submit printed copies of your application and certified documents to the Academic and Students’ Affairs Division.Steps to Apply for UENR Admissions 2026/2027
- Check Requirements: Ensure you meet the entry requirements for your program, typically requiring WASSCE/SSSCE credits in core and elective subjects.
- Purchase E-Voucher: Buy the application form from GCB Bank, Ghana Post, Zenith Bank, Prudential Bank, or Fidelity Bank. You can also dial
*885#on all networks to purchase. - Apply Online: Visit the official Admissions Portal to enter your application number and PIN to begin.
- Fill Form & Upload Documents: Fill in your personal information, educational history, and upload required documents, such as transcripts and certificates.
- Review and Submit: Thoroughly review your application before submitting to ensure accuracy.
- Submit Documents: Print the completed online form and submit it to the Academic and Students’ Affairs Division, UENR.
Key Information
- Application Fees: Diploma/Undergraduate is approximately GHS 230, and Postgraduate is GHS 300.
- Contact Info: The University of Energy and Natural Resources (UENR) has campuses in Sunyani, Nsoatre, and Dormaa Ahenkro.
